The Evolution of AI Ethics

The landscape of artificial intelligence (AI) ethics has undergone significant transformation since its inception. Early discussions focused primarily on the theoretical implications of machine behavior and decision-making processes. One of the earliest milestones in AI ethics emerged in the mid-20th century with the development of Isaac Asimov’s Three Laws of Robotics. These foundational ethical principles laid the groundwork for future discourse, emphasizing the need for consideration of human safety and the moral dilemmas posed by autonomous systems. As AI technologies advanced, ethical considerations grew increasingly complex.

Throughout the late 20th and early 21st centuries, various controversies highlighted the societal ramifications of AI. Notable incidents, such as the biased algorithms in police predictive policing and recruitment software, ignited public debate about fairness and accountability in AI systems. These events provoked reactions from both the public and regulatory bodies, leading to a growing recognition of the need for robust ethical guidelines. As AI began permeating daily life, including healthcare, finance, and transportation, the implications of its deployment became more pronounced. Governments and organizations began to issue frameworks that advocated responsible AI practices, emphasizing fairness, transparency, and the protection of individual rights.

By 2025, the integration of AI into everyday applications continued to stir public discourse, particularly concerning data privacy and surveillance. The controversies surrounding misinformation spread by AI-generated content further intensified scrutiny regarding ethical standards. This evolving landscape has prompted a shift in public perception; where AI was once viewed predominantly as a novel technological advancement, it began to be characterized by its socio-political dimensions, raising questions about who benefits from AI technologies. The discourse surrounding AI ethics is now multi-dimensional, reflecting the urgency of aligning AI’s capabilities with ethical practices to foster trust and safeguard societal values.

Regulatory Frameworks in 2025

By the year 2025, numerous governments and international bodies have established or proposed comprehensive regulatory frameworks to address the ethical challenges posed by artificial intelligence (AI). These regulations aim to promote transparency, ensure accountability, and mitigate potential risks associated with AI technologies. Notably, these frameworks often encompass principles such as fairness, privacy protection, and the prevention of discrimination, which are critical in maintaining public trust.

One significant example of regulatory initiative is the European Union’s AI Act, which categorizes AI systems based on their risk levels. High-risk systems must comply with strict regulatory requirements, including rigorous testing and documentation, which serve to validate their safety and efficacy before deployment. Furthermore, this act emphasizes the importance of human oversight, mandating that AI technologies be designed in a way that allows for human intervention when necessary. This approach underlines the necessity of maintaining human agency within automated processes.

In addition to the EU, other regions have proposed regulations that align with shared ethical values. For instance, the United States has encouraged a sector-specific framework that advocates for standards enabling innovation while ensuring safety and ethical adherence. This encourages compliance among stakeholders, including AI developers and users, thus fostering synergy between regulatory bodies and the industry. Case studies from jurisdictions such as Canada and Singapore demonstrate effective implementation, showcasing these nations’ proactive measures in embedding ethical considerations into their AI strategies.

The role of industry stakeholders is crucial in shaping these regulations. Collaboration between governments, technologists, and ethicists is essential for developing frameworks that not only address compliance requirements but also encourage innovation. Through continuous dialogue, a balanced approach can ensure that the benefits of AI are maximized while minimizing ethical risks. As the landscape of AI evolves, these regulatory frameworks will likely adapt to emerging challenges, reinforcing their importance in the governance of AI technologies.

Challenges and Dilemmas in AI Regulation

The rapid advancement of artificial intelligence (AI) technologies presents significant challenges and dilemmas for regulators aiming to balance innovation with ethical standards. One of the foremost issues is privacy, as AI systems often require vast amounts of data to function effectively. This collection of personal information raises critical questions regarding informed consent, data ownership, and the potential for misuse. Regulators must navigate the tension between fostering innovation in AI while ensuring robust privacy protections for individuals.

Another substantial concern in AI regulation is the issue of bias. AI algorithms are only as good as the data on which they are trained. If that data contains biases, the resulting decision-making processes can perpetuate or even exacerbate societal inequalities. Thus, ensuring fairness and accountability in AI systems poses a considerable challenge. Regulatory bodies must establish frameworks that not only identify and address biases in AI but also promote inclusive practices that reflect diverse perspectives and experiences.

The dynamic nature of AI technology further complicates the regulatory landscape. With advancements occurring at an unprecedented pace, there is a pressing need for adaptive regulations that can keep up with these developments. Static regulatory frameworks risk becoming obsolete, failing to address the complexities and nuances associated with emerging AI capabilities. Stakeholders, including technologists who develop these systems, ethicists who analyze their implications, businesses looking for competitive advantages, and civil society advocating for ethical standards, each offer distinct perspectives that must be considered in the regulatory process.

As discussions around AI regulation continue to evolve, finding a middle ground that enables innovation while adhering to ethical principles remains an ongoing challenge. Emphasizing collaboration among various stakeholders will be essential for creating regulations that are both effective and adaptable to the future landscape of AI technology.
